Qualifications:
- Proficiency in American Sign Language (ASL) and current Sign Language Interpreter certification
- Prior experience interpreting in educational settings highly preferred
- Ability to adapt communication style to students’ needs and age groups
- Dedication to maintaining confidentiality and professional boundaries
- Reliability, flexibility, and a passion for supporting student success
Responsibilities:
- Provide comprehensive sign language interpretation for students, educators, and school staff in classrooms and campus activities
- Facilitate clear and effective communication to ensure equal access to educational content
- Collaborate with teachers and special education teams to support individualized learning plans
- Foster an inclusive, supportive atmosphere for deaf and hard-of-hearing students
